The Heart of Your Vehicle: Understanding the Engine

Your vehicle's engine is its heart, powering everything from acceleration to fuel efficiency. Understanding its components and functioning is key to maintaining a healthy vehicle.

Why Regular Engine Maintenance Matters

Regular maintenance prevents unexpected breakdowns, improves fuel efficiency, and extends the engine's lifespan. A well-maintained engine runs cleaner and produces fewer emissions, which is good for the environment.

Essential Maintenance Practices

1. **Oil Changes**: Regular oil changes are vital. Oil lubricates engine parts, reducing friction and preventing wear. Change your oil every 5,000 to 7,500 miles.

2. **Air Filters**: Dirty air filters can harm engine performance. Regularly replacing these filters ensures that your engine receives clean air for combustion.

3. **Coolant Flushes**: Overheating can cause significant damage. Regular coolant flushes ensure the engine stays cool, especially during hot months.

When to Seek Professional Help

If you notice any unusual sounds, vibrations, or warning lights on your dashboard, it’s vital to consult a professional automotive service. Don't wait for minor issues to escalate into major repairs.
